Transaction f62c517b903da9939a80d5c6544f50529b71f8c2277ed79228970edb3fcd4922

1 Input
2 Outputs
  • f62c517b903da9939a80d5c6544f50529b71f8c2277ed79228970edb3fcd4922:0
  • value  100000
    address  3K5sgC5nusVTRPFPWdiFj9m8yUuTEvdMCg
  • f62c517b903da9939a80d5c6544f50529b71f8c2277ed79228970edb3fcd4922:1
  • value  159987147
    address  37gAh6CD8KzvAj2sw5TYFHukc285uxd873